WebFeb 23, 2007 · Identification. The familiar Chaffinch is one of our commonest breeding birds. In flight it lacks the white rump of the Brambling and has obvious white sides to the tail and a flash of white in the wings. … WebThe common chaffinch measures 14.5 cm long and has a wingspan of 24.5 to 28.5 cm. WebHow to recognise a chaffinch egg. Female chaffinches lay four to five bluish eggs per clutch. The eggs are around 19 x 15 millimetres in size and are covered with brown-purple spots. Chaffinches protect their eggs in a nest made of grass, moss, roots and tiny twigs. Nests are cupped, padded with feathers and camouflaged on the outside with ... WebWhat it looks like: males: reddish-brown back, dark brown wings with two white bands, black tail with white sides, underside is merlot to white at bottom of belly, head and neck blue-gray and black forehead. By Team Beauty of Birds. The Chaffinch ( Fringilla coelebs) is a small finch (family Fringillidae) that is widespread and common throughout Europe. Its range extends into western Asia, northwestern Africa, the Canary Islands and Madeira.
